EM260
5.2.5
Spacing
To ensure that the EM260 is always able to deal with incoming commands, a minimum inter-command spacing
is defined at 1ms. After every transaction, the Host must hold the Slave Select high for a minimum of 1ms.
The Host must respect the inter-command spacing requirement, or the EM260 will not have time to operate on
the command; additional commands could result in error conditions or undesired behavior. If the nHOST_INT
signal is not already asserted, the Host is allowed to use the Wake handshake instead of the inter-command
spacing to determine if the EM260 is ready to accept a command.
5.2.6
Waking the EM260 from Sleep
Waking up the EM260 involves a simple handshaking routine as illustrated in Figure 6. This handshaking insures
that the Host will wait until the EM260 is fully awake and ready to accept commands from the Host. If the
EM260 is already awake when the handshake is performed (such as when the Host resets and the EM260 is
already operating), the handshake will proceed as described below with no ill effects.
Note: A wake handshake cannot be performed if nHOST_INT is already asserted.
Note: nWAKE should not be asserted after the EM260 has been reset until the EM260 has fully booted, as
indicated by the EM260 asserting nHOST_INT. If nWAKE is asserted during this boot time, the EM260 may enter
bootloader mode. See section 5.6.1, Bootloading the EM260.
nWAKE
nHOST_INT
Figure 6. EM260 Wake Sequence
Waking the EM260 involves the following steps:
1.
2.
3.
4.
5.
6.
7.
8.
Host asserts nWAKE.
EM260 interrupts on nWAKE and exits sleep.
EM260 performs all operations it needs to and will not respond until it is ready to accept commands.
EM260 asserts nHOST_INT within 300ms of nWAKE asserting. If the EM260 does not assert nHOST_INT
within 300ms of nWAKE, it is valid for the Host to consider the EM260 unresponsive and to reset the
EM260.
Host detects nHOST_INT assertion. Since the assertion of nHOST_INT indicates the EM260 can accept SPI
transactions, the Host does not need to hold Slave Select high for the normally required minimum 1ms of
inter-command spacing.
Host deasserts nWAKE after detecting nHOST_INT assertion.
EM260 will deassert nHOST_INT within 25 μ s of nWAKE deasserting.
After 25 μ s, any change on nHOST_INT will be an indication of a normal asynchronous (callback) event.
5.2.7
Error Conditions
If two or more different error conditions occur back to back, only the first error condition will be reported to
the Host (if it is possible to report the error). The following are error conditions that might occur with the
EM260.
Unsupported SPI Command: If the SPI Byte of the command is unsupported, the EM260 will drop the incoming
command and respond with the Unsupported SPI Command Error Response. This error means the SPI Byte is
120-0260-000M Rev 1.1
Page 24
相关PDF资料
EM35X-NCP-ADD-ON-S EM35X ADD ON KIT
EM6J1T2R MOSFET 2P-CH 20V 200MA EMT6
EM6K6T2R MOSFET 2N-CH 20V 300MA EMT6
EM6K7T2R MOSFET 2N-CH 20V 200MA EMT6
EM6M1T2R MOSFET N/P-CH 30V .1A EMT6
EM6M2T2R MOSFET N/P-CH 20V 200MA EMT6
EMH1303-TL-E MOSFET P-CH 12V 7A EMH8
EMH1307-TL-H MOSFET P-CH 20V 6.5A EMH8
相关代理商/技术参数
EM260-DEV 功能描述:KIT DEV FOR EM260 RoHS:否 类别:RF/IF 和 RFID >> RF 评估和开发套件,板 系列:InSight 标准包装:1 系列:- 类型:GPS 接收器 频率:1575MHz 适用于相关产品:- 已供物品:模块 其它名称:SER3796
EM260-RCM-USART-R 功能描述:EM260 RCM BOARD RoHS:是 类别:RF/IF 和 RFID >> RF 评估和开发套件,板 系列:- 标准包装:1 系列:- 类型:GPS 接收器 频率:1575MHz 适用于相关产品:- 已供物品:模块 其它名称:SER3796
EM260-RTR 功能描述:IC ZIGBEE SYSTEM-ON-CHIP 40-QFN RoHS:是 类别:RF/IF 和 RFID >> RF 收发器 系列:- 产品培训模块:Lead (SnPb) Finish for COTS Obsolescence Mitigation Program 标准包装:30 系列:- 频率:4.9GHz ~ 5.9GHz 数据传输率 - 最大:54Mbps 调制或协议:* 应用:* 功率 - 输出:-3dBm 灵敏度:- 电源电压:2.7 V ~ 3.6 V 电流 - 接收:* 电流 - 传输:* 数据接口:PCB,表面贴装 存储容量:- 天线连接器:PCB,表面贴装 工作温度:-25°C ~ 85°C 封装/外壳:68-TQFN 裸露焊盘 包装:管件
EM260-RTY 功能描述:IC ZIGBEE SYSTEM-ON-CHIP 40-QFN RoHS:是 类别:RF/IF 和 RFID >> RF 收发器 系列:- 产品培训模块:Lead (SnPb) Finish for COTS Obsolescence Mitigation Program 标准包装:30 系列:- 频率:4.9GHz ~ 5.9GHz 数据传输率 - 最大:54Mbps 调制或协议:* 应用:* 功率 - 输出:-3dBm 灵敏度:- 电源电压:2.7 V ~ 3.6 V 电流 - 接收:* 电流 - 传输:* 数据接口:PCB,表面贴装 存储容量:- 天线连接器:PCB,表面贴装 工作温度:-25°C ~ 85°C 封装/外壳:68-TQFN 裸露焊盘 包装:管件
EM260-USART-JMP-R 功能描述:KIT JUMP START FOR EM260 RoHS:否 类别:RF/IF 和 RFID >> RF 评估和开发套件,板 系列:JumpStart 标准包装:1 系列:- 类型:GPS 接收器 频率:1575MHz 适用于相关产品:- 已供物品:模块 其它名称:SER3796
EM2630-12# 制造商:Fluke Electronics 功能描述:BNC (F) TO ALLIGATOR CLIPS 12 INCHES 制造商:Pomona Electronics 功能描述:
EM-26392-C36 功能描述:麦克风 3.61 X 3.61 X 2.21MM -51 SENS, 12SL PORT RoHS:否 制造商:Knowles Acoustics 方向性:Omnidirectional 阻抗:4.4 K Ohms 工作电压:0.9 V to 10 V 灵敏度:- 53 dB 端接类型:Wire Leads 长度:5.56 mm 宽度:3.98 mm 深度:2.21 mm
EM-26596-C36 功能描述:麦克风 3.61 X 3.61 X 2.21MM -52 SENS, 12B PORT RoHS:否 制造商:Knowles Acoustics 方向性:Omnidirectional 阻抗:4.4 K Ohms 工作电压:0.9 V to 10 V 灵敏度:- 53 dB 端接类型:Wire Leads 长度:5.56 mm 宽度:3.98 mm 深度:2.21 mm